I have clicked by mistake on a network icon down on an Email message. There supposed to be an attachment. Thunderbird went offline. Jerry

I have clicked by mistake on a network icon down on an Email message. There supposed to be an attachment. Thunderbird went offline. Jerry

Chosen solution

two little blue monitors in the bottom left of the screen. Click them
